TP最新版本是一个非常受欢迎的多链数字货币钱包,支持多种区块链资产的管理与交易。为了更好地使用TP最新版本,用户可以自定义RPC(远程过程调用)设置,以连接到特定的区块链网络或节点。通过自定义RPC设置,用户可以提高交易速度、增强网络连接的稳定性,或者连接到个性化的区块链项目。本文将详细介绍如何在TP最新版本中自定义RPC设置,并针对相关问题进行深入分析。
什么是RPC,为什么需要自定义RPC?
RPC,远程过程调用(Remote Procedure Call),是一种协议,使得不同计算机或进程能够互相通信和请求服务。在区块链环境中,RPC协议允许用户与区块链节点进行交互,比如发送交易、查询余额等。当用户使用钱包时,通常会通过已配置的RPC节点来进行操作。
在某些情况下,默认的RPC节点可能会出现延迟、拥堵或不稳定的情况。这时,用户可以选择自定义RPC,连接到其他节点,获得更快和更稳定的服务。自定义RPC能够让用户自由选择网络,提高操作灵活性。例如,某些用户可能会需要连接到开发测试网络,或是一些专门的私人链。
如何在TP最新版本中自定义RPC设置?
要在TP最新版本中自定义RPC设置,可以按照以下步骤操作:
- 打开TP最新版本应用,确保已登录。
- 在主界面上,找到并点击右上角的“设置”图标。
- 在设置界面中,选择“网络”或“区块链”选项。
- 点击“添加节点”或“自定义RPC”按钮。
- 在弹出的界面中,输入相应的节点信息,如名称、RPC URL、链ID等,并保存设置。
- 返回网络列表,选择刚刚添加的自定义节点进行连接。
填写节点信息时,需要确认信息的准确性,例如RPC URL必须与所连接的区块链匹配,否则可能导致无法连接或出现错误。
自定义RPC的常见问题与解决方案
在自定义RPC设置中,用户可能会遇到各种问题,以下是一些常见的疑问及其解决方案:
1. RPC连接失败的原因是什么?
当用户尝试连接自定义RPC节点时,可能会遇到连接失败的情况。以下是一些可能的原因:
- RPC URL不正确:检查已输入的RPC URL是否正确,包括协议(如http或https)、端口号和路径等信息。
- 节点故障:检查所连接的RPC节点是否在线。可以尝试访问节点的官方渠道或社区,查看节点的健康状态。
- 网络确保设备网络正常,检查是否有防火墙或其他安全软件阻止了网络连接。
- 链ID错误:确认所填写的链ID正确,这会影响与区块链的交互。
2. 如何选择合适的RPC节点?
选择合适的RPC节点对于用户的交易体验至关重要。以下是选择RPC节点时应考虑的因素:
- 节点的稳定性:应选择一些经过验证且具有良好声誉的节点,以确保其稳定运行。
- 地理位置:近距离的节点通常连接速度更快,可以减少数据传输延迟。
- 拥堵情况:查看节点的使用状况,避免选择高负载的节点,以提高响应速度。
- 兼容性:确保节点的RPC接口与TP最新版本的要求相匹配,以避免不兼容问题。
3. 自定义RPC设置是否会影响钱包安全?
使用自定义RPC节点可能会对钱包安全产生影响。以下是影响因素:
- 信任连接到不知名的RPC节点可能带来安全风险,攻击者可以通过恶意节点获取用户的敏感信息。因此,建议使用知名的节点,或是自己搭建节点。
- 数据隐私:某些节点可能会记录用户的交易信息,导致隐私泄露。在选择节点时,应注意其隐私政策。
- 防止钓鱼风险:确保输入的RPC URL是官方提供的,避免进入钓鱼站点。
4. 自定义RPC的优势与劣势是什么?
自定义RPC有其独特的优势和劣势,用户在使用时需要权衡利弊:
- 优势:
1) 提高交易速度:选择更快的节点可以提升交易执行效率。
2) 稳定性:一些用户所选的节点可以提供更好的稳定性,降低交易失败率。
3) 定制化:用户可以根据不同需求,选择与自己交易类型、区域、项目等匹配的节点。
- 劣势:
1) 风险:使用不知名的节点可能存在安全隐患。
2) 复杂性:设置自定义RPC可能对新手用户带来困惑,需要一定的技术基础来操作。
3) 维护:用户需要定期检查所用节点的状态,以确保其正常运作和性能。
总的来说,自定义RPC是在TP最新版本中使用体验的一种方式,通过遵循上述指南,用户可以成功设置自定义RPC并应对可能出现的问题。
此文旨在为用户提供详细的信息和指引,以帮助他们在TP最新版本中顺利完成RPC的自定义设置。如果您有更多的问题,欢迎在TP最新版本的官方社区中寻求帮助,或联系相关的技术支持。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。